Description of problem: When trying to use pinentry-gtk in Fluxbox/Blackbox it sometimes fails to grab keyboard and this results in cancelled pin input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): current (0.8.0-1) (also applied to 0.8.0-2 on F-13 How reproducible: sometimes Steps to Reproduce: run echo getpin | pinentry-gtk while using Fluxbox/Blackbox WM. You might need to run it a few times to hit the race condition Actual results: Pinentry closes with error message that it was unable to grab keyboard Expected results: Window with pinentry dialog should show up Additional info:
